PSLE Cindy had a total of 194 blue and silver beads. She used 26 blue beads and 20% of the silver beads. After that, the ratio of the number of blue beads to silver beads Cindy had was 9 : 4.
- What fraction of her silver beads did Cindy use? Give your answer in the simplest form.
- How many beads did Cindy have in the end?

The number of silver beads in the end is repeated.
Since the numbers are already the same, we do not need to use LCM to make them the same.
Number of silver beads at first = 5 u
Number of blue beads at first = 9 u + 26
Total number of beads at first
= 5 u + 9 u + 26
= 14 u + 26
14 u + 26 = 194
14 u = 194 - 26
14 u = 168
1 u = 168 ÷ 14 = 12
Number of silver beads in the end = 4 u
Number of blue beads in the end = 9 u
Total number of beads in the end
= 9 u + 4 u
= 13 u
= 13 x 12
= 156
